Before diving into the specifics of Julia Ramos’s contributions, it’s essential to understand the context of St. Louis Park itself. Located just west of Minneapolis, the city boasts a rich history, a diverse population, and a strong commitment to sustainable living. From its expansive park system, including the popular Westwood Hills Nature Center, to its thriving local businesses and nationally recognized school district, St. Louis Park offers a high quality of life to its residents.
